Applications are invited for the above post from suitably qualified persons.
The Quality Improvement and Accreditation Officer will be responsible for leading and managing accreditation and quality improvement processes within the NRH. The primary function of this role is to actively promote a culture of continuous quality improvement with a focus on the external accreditation programme. This will include working in partnership with all staff to promote and foster optimum participation of the Hospital with accreditation schemes, and for continuous development of a quality culture, which maintains the primacy of the patient as the centre and a focus on quality improvement.
It is essential that candidates at the latest date for receiving completed application forms for the post, possess:
- A relevant third level or healthcare professional qualification
- At least three years relevant experience in a senior post in quality improvement / risk management / healthcare audit or an accreditation process, ideally in a healthcare environment
- Significant leadership, interpersonal and organisational skills
- Ability to utilise analytics in quality monitoring and reporting
- Excellent communication and negotiating skills
- A master's degree or post graduate qualification in a quality related discipline is desirable.
